Art Appreciation
The Art Appreciation group at the moment does not have fixed days or dates when it meets but in
the winter months we meet in the Lower Holker Village Hall supper room which is on the first floor
( LHVH is actually in Cark in Cartmel ) from 14:30 to 16:30.
We mainly visit art galleries : near and far or Romney society talks and go to Beetham Heron
Theatre to see Exhibition on Screen films with a discussion afterwards either at Beetham
Nurseries ( summer ) or the Hare and Hounds in Levens from November to March . The group
tries to use public transport as much as possible but we have hired a minibus to go to more
inaccessible places.
The group has evolved since it started in 2019 and is open to new ways of seeing and learning
about Art in all its forms. Members are invited to do presentations of their choice or to suggest
visits or other activities with the view to helping organise our monthly sessions. There will be a
planning meeting in the summer months where members will have the opportunity to get involved
in the group in the spirit of U3a.
